We thoroughly enjoyed our weeklong stay at The Pump House. The property met our "high" stanadars for cleanliness. It is bright, cheery, nicely appointed. Modern yet authentic. Although it was cool and chilly outside, we were cozy and comfortable inside. The bed with duvet was devine! The welcome breakfast pack was nice and bottle of wine a treat. The owners were friendly and helpful, providing us with information on nearby activities. It was so quiet at night, we knew we were in the country. We could see stars through the skylight. We visited the Farmer's Market on Sunday at the Athy Square. Since we had a rental car, we drove to Tallaght and took the Luas, light rail train, into Dublin for shopping and sightseeing. That was fun and relaxing. We took a day trip to Waterford and had dinner in Tomastown at Mt. Juliet. We visited Citiwest and The Outlet Shops. I would highly recommend The Pump House for a stay in the Irish countryside.
